摘要

Grafting of cyclodextrin(CD)molecules in suitable fabrics provides hosting cavities that can include a large viriety of chemicals for specific texitle finishing.In this study we permanently grafted deta-CD onto the surface of a cellulosic fabric,namely Tencel according to different procedures.After the treatment,benzoic acid,vanillin,iodine,N,N-diethyl-m-toluamide,and dimethyl-phthalate were loaded,by either spraying their solutions on the CD-grafted fabric ,ir by grafting the jpreviously prepared inclusion compound on Tencel. The untreated and treated fabrics were evaluated through scanning electron microscopy,differential scanning calorimetry,UV-vis spectra,X-ray diffractometry,water absorbency,breaking load loss,aroma and antimicrobial finishing tests.Our results indicate that the included compounds are efficiently hosted in the CD cavities,and the fabric's surface properties are not significantly modified by the chemical treatments.
